Loveday Antiques has dated this German Walnut Serpentine Commode to the 18th Century.
German - Probably made in Braunschweig Circa 1740
Having exotic ebony inlay to the sides and pewter and ivory inlay to the top, drawer fronts and pilasters, the brass handles look to be period replacements dating to circa 1800. The form is typical of the best German commodes of this period.

Having acquired a fabulous colour and eye-catching inlay.The geometrically banded top also incorporates a beautiful pewter and ivory cartouche with the cypher of the original owner in the centre and two allegorical figures on pewter pedestals which are very much in the French 17th century style. The whole raised on scroll carved bracket feet.

A piece of this sort would have been made to order for a wealthy and important client and no expense was spared in its design or construction.
